Description
SK48NW ASTON-CUM-AUGHTON PARK HILL (north side) 5/15 Cowhouse flanking east 21.8.86 side of farm-yeard at Park Hill Farm
GV II Cowhouse with hayloft. Early-mid C19. Coursed, dressed red sandstone, Welsh slate roof. 2 storeys, 5 bays. Wallstone plinth. Door with wedge lintel to bay 2, altered doorways to bays 1 and 4, windows to bays 3 and 5. 1st-floor band beneath 5 circular pitching holes with dressed surrounds. Eaves band, hipped roof. Rear: 5 pitching holes as front. Left return: blocked triple slit vents to ground floor, matching pitching hole above. Faces contemporary barn and forms important element of U-shaped planned farm group. Included for group value.
